Chord Company Launches first Power Distributor

Calling it a "power strip" would not do it justice. According to the manufacturer, Chord Company's Master M6 and Studio S6 power distribution units, called PowerHAUS, can do much more than ordinary or even high-quality power strips.

The British cable specialist Chord Company from Wiltshire unveiled the PowerHAUS distributors, which are intended to represent an uncompromising combination of design expertise, diversity in use and high manufacturing quality. The "HAUS" in PowerHAUS stands for „Hybrid Aray Unfiltered Supply“ and is available in the quality grades "Studio" and "Master". The power unit with 6 slots was developed technically as well as optically in lengthy tests, which were already started in the year 2003, as stated by the manufacturer. Various technologies known from the cable series were the basis for the development, but were however developed further with particular attention to the requirements of mains distribution.

Both mains distribution blocks, PowerHAUS M6 as well as PowerHAUS S6, do not use active filters, switches or any neon lights for power indication, as these could reduce and/or degrade sound quality, according to the Chord Company. Their solid aluminum construction is also designed to minimize the effects of microphonics. Instead of using star-shaped wiring, Chord Company's research revealed that three strictly isolated and parallel solid copper bus bars and the consistent physical separation of the earth bar from the phase and neutral conductors are supposed to yield sonic gains.

The flagship Master M6 is said to offer the best overall performance and uses three hybrid MainsARAYs connected in parallel (NOT in series). Both models have a separate ground connector. The mains cable can be freely chosen by the customer, detailed recommendations are provided by participating retailers*. Suggested retail prices are €1,295* for the PowerHAUS S6 and €2,595* for the PowerHAUS M6.
